    I started with all W/B's. Sold those. Started buying Stern LE's. Sold/traded most of those . Started buying back W/B's. Now I find I am buying some Stern Pro models.
    Purchased a HUO WD pro and a NIB SW pro. Not sure I will buy any LE's anymore. The price of a Pro, new or resale, is 60 to 75% of an LE/Prem. True they do not have as many features as the upper scale models but they have more value for the money. The code on both my pro models is pretty impressive.

    Being fortunate to have a larger collection, I find , I bounce back and forth between all my games. I especially like when I fall back in love with a game that I have not played for a while. I just did that with I500. A real cool speed game.
